In Australia, a full time Performance Analyst generally earns $2,271 per week ($118,092 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.
This industry is likely to see strong growth in employment numbers in coming years. There are currently 13,500 people working in this sector in Australia and many of them specialise as a Performance Analyst. Performance Analysts may find work across all regions of Australia, particularly larger towns and cities.
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ights
